Transaction 42462835285ae343dd340d4e2b576b4d8b71e9a19151bfc9eabd5a26ddb068d7

1 Input
2 Outputs
  • 42462835285ae343dd340d4e2b576b4d8b71e9a19151bfc9eabd5a26ddb068d7:0
  • value  543800
    address  34oTfhWufpR5kp7Bmqp3qEXaxEbQbvhZbu
  • 42462835285ae343dd340d4e2b576b4d8b71e9a19151bfc9eabd5a26ddb068d7:1
  • value  211335
    address  39SxW1vEZkhKm6UtP1E5jMkBdYx9RGzvgV